The study focuses on a unique group of Orthodox Christians in Greece who, for religious reasons, abstain from animal products for roughly half the year. What makes this particularly fascinating is that their dietary restrictions aren’t driven by health trends or ethical concerns but by centuries-old religious practices. This creates a natural experiment that scientists can’t easily replicate in a lab. The Hidden Chemistry of Dietary Shifts

One thing that immediately stands out is the study’s focus on gene expression. Researchers found that just a few weeks of plant-based eating altered the activity of certain genes, particularly those linked to metabolism and fat storage. For instance, participants with a specific gene variant showed signs of adipose tissue beiging, a process where energy-storing white fat cells start behaving more like calorie-burning brown fat cells. What this really suggests is that diet isn’t just about calories in versus calories out—it’s about how food interacts with your genetic blueprint.

What many people don’t realize is that this isn’t just a minor tweak in the body’s machinery. The study highlights how a protein called FGF21, which plays a key role in metabolism, is significantly influenced by these dietary changes. The Cholesterol Connection

Another detail that I find especially interesting is the study’s findings on cholesterol. Participants who gave up meat and dairy saw changes in a gene variant linked to the production of cholesterol. This isn’t just about lowering cholesterol levels—it’s about how the body compensates for reduced dietary intake. The researchers speculate that this genetic response might offer some protection against obesity, which hints at a broader interplay between diet, genetics, and disease risk.
